In the Days of Blue and Silver

CP (Portugal) French-built road switcher 1205 waits for a passenger train to clear before continuing south with a short freight. These roadswitchers were very common in France at the time. This scene was recorded on October 10, 1966, at Fornos de Algodres, Portugal. Fornos de Algodres is a small municipality in the Guarda District, west of Guarda.
